The movie I am now inspired to see is "Life of Pi" -- has anyone seen it?
I saw it during it's opening weekend and thought it was a really good movie.It was visually stunning with a simplistic,spiritual message.I saw it in a theater shown in 3D,and I'm glad I did.For me,the movie scenery was probably 80% of the appeal.
Before I had seen it,I had heard that it was heavily religious based,which gave me cause for concern.I found that not to be the case though,it was spiritual,not religous IMO.As much as I enjoy the violence and adult themed movies like Django Unchained,The Life of Pi was a refreshing change of pace for me.It's a movie that's appropriate for any age group,although most children would miss the message in it.
Quite honestly,The life of Pi exceeded my expectations and I'd recommend seeing it.
